What is fourteen and five ninths plus six and seven ninths

Mathematics
2 answers:
Setler [38]3 years ago
8 0
In number form, your question is:
14 5/9 + 6 7/9 = ?
We can now understand this easier, and answer it.
Add your whole numbers first to not get confused.
14 + 6 = 20.
Now add your fractions.
5/9 + 7/9 = 12/9, = 1 3/9.
Add 1 to your whole number.
20 + 1 = 21.
You are left with 21 3/9.
Your answer is 21 3/9.
